US: Small jets fail to solve bigger problems
(Source : Star-Telegram, September 26, 2004)
Regional jets -- once hailed as saviours of the airline industry -- aren't necessarily the solutions for every problem, aviation experts say. 'There has been a real consumer backlash against these airplanes,' a consultant said. 'People hate them for any flight longer than an hour or so.' While more expensive to operate in terms of the cost per seat, the regional jets were seen as a cost-effective alternative because the big airplanes often had many empty seats. Regional jets are effective in serving small communities, but their advantage vanishes when they compete with full-size airplanes, said a consultant. 'You saw the majors throw 50-seat regional jets against the [discount airlines] and against mainline jets,' he said. 'That's a classic mistake because the customer feels like he's getting a subpar product.'
